What is the Parametric Equations Circle Graphing Activity?

The Parametric Equations Circle Graphing Activity is designed to engage high school students in grades 9-12 with the concept of parametric equations and their application in graphing circles. This educational activity focuses on translating centers and rotating polygons, facilitating a deeper understanding of geometric and algebraic principles. Students will learn to manipulate equations, graph circles, and achieve specific learning outcomes aligned with curriculum standards.
As part of this activity, learners will write parametric equations and match them to their corresponding graphs. The inclusion of a structured worksheet enhances the educational experience while providing an effective learning tool for students.
